MBA Schools vs Global Downturn
The world has been making noises about the role the business schools, especially Harvard Business School, played in bringing about the global financial downturn. Doubts on the culpability of the B-schools began a long time back when the Enron being run by Jeffrey Skilling, an HBS product went bankrupt. Then came, John Thain, the former CEO of Merrill Lynch, and Christopher Cox, former chairman of the Securities and Exchange Commission both products of HBS and mired in controversies.

Amity and Max New York Life in alliance to launches PG Diploma Insurance Sales Management
Amity Global Business School and Max New York Life have stuck an alliance to offer a one year PG Diploma program in Insurance Sales Management at its Noida, Jaipur, Hyderabad, Indore and Kolkata campuses. After the end of the program, Max New York Life assures placements at managerial level which is a subject to meeting minimum eligibility criteria. The selection will be through a process of career counseling, written test or CAT/GMAT scores and personal interview. The last date of application for the course is June 1, 2009.

ISB to hold on-campus job-fair to woo corporates
After almost eight years of its inception and path-breaking success, Indian School of Business (ISB) Hyderabads placements hit a bottleneck this year owing to the global meltdown. The Career Advancement Services (CAS) office at the ISB has therefore come up with a unique idea to wade through the turbulent 2009 placement season. For the first time in history of any top-tier Indian B-school, the ISB-CAS has organised a job fair to facilitate interaction between the students and recruiters.
Harvard to accept GRE scores too; MBA students to benefit
Harvard Business Schools (HBS) recent decision allowing MBA aspirants to submit test scores from either GMAT (Graduate Management Admissions Test) or GRE (Graduate Record Examination) for its general two-year program has opened gates of vast avenues for students all over the globe. This decision is bound to bring about positive effects on the preparation patterns of the Indian student community.
Emerging markets: Monitor Group study offers lessons in business excellence
What makes businesses succeed in emerging markets, where the customer profile and demands are quite different from more affluent western markets? Monitor Inclusive Markets, part of the consulting company Monitor Group firms, has released Emerging Markets, Emerging Models, a report analyzing the actual behaviors, economics, and business models of successful market-based solutionsfinancially-sustainable enterprises that address challenges of global poverty.
